Scarification can actually have a positive effect on the rate of germination for certain seeds. By nicking, scratching, or softening the seed coat, scarification can help water and oxygen reach the embryo more easily, thus promoting germination. It can be especially helpful for seeds with hard or impermeable seed coats.

During germination, a seed's respiration rate increases as it activates metabolic processes to support growth. In contrast, non-germinating seeds have a lower respiration rate as they are in a dormant state. As germination progresses, the respiration rate of the seed will continue to rise to meet the demands of growth.

Coumarin is a plant compound that can inhibit seed germination by affecting enzyme activity or disrupting hormone balance in seeds. It may delay or reduce the rate of germination in some plant species by interfering with essential metabolic processes.
